I guess the record for Susannah 1801 - 1862 is your tree (search on "Susannah Harmon 1801"). If not yours you should check it out as here she marries David G Bowers and her fathers name is given as John Harmon. The G almost certainly stands for Grim as his mother was Mary Grim.
Is there any chance that Susannah Harmon married twice. If this possible then check out Susannah born in Durham, Androscoggin County, Maine, USA, on 05 October 1801 to Francis Harmon and Betsey Dyer. Apparently she married David Rogers, 14 March 1825, and they had six children. Bit of a long shot as would give her a total of 20 children !
